Overview

·    This is a Texas Commission on Law Enforcement (TCOLE) elective Drone Pilot - UAS Part 107 Test Preparation #4033 online training course offered for Texas Peace Officers, non-TCOLE officers, national law enforcement officers, Jailers, and Telecommunicators.

Prepare for the FAA's Part 107 exam with our expertly designed comprehensive course for beginners and experienced drone pilots. This course covers everything you need to pass the FAA exam and become a certified drone operator. This comprehensive course ensures you're ready to pass the test and equipped to be a safe, knowledgeable, and responsible drone operator.

COURSE HIGHLIGHTS

In-Depth Coverage: Topics include airspace classifications, weather, flight operations, crew resource management, and emergency procedures.

Interactive Learning: Engage with interactive lessons, quizzes, and scenario-based exercises to reinforce key concepts.

Test Simulations: Take practice exams that mimic the actual FAA test to build confidence and identify areas for improvement.

Latest Updates: Stay current with lessons on night operations, operations over people, and the latest FAA regulations, including remote ID requirements.

Expert Instruction: Drone flight instructors with aviation experience develop and teach our course.

Flexible Access: Lifetime access to all materials so you can review and study at your own pace.

TCOLE Reporting

OSS Academy® typically reports 4 to 5 times each week [excluding U.S. Federal holidays]. We report your credit directly through TCLEDDS to the Texas Commission on Law Enforcement [TCOLE]. You should have already provided your full and correct name, TCOLE PID number, and other important information when registering for your account. If not, once logged in, go to Edit Profile to update your information.
